Zsombor Piros and Jerome Kym meet in the quarterfinals of the 2026 Iasi Challenger on clay, with both players advancing through the round of 16 in the past 48 hours. Piros, ranked 169 and strong on the surface this season, rallied past third seed Damir Dzumhur 4-6, 6-4, 6-3 after dropping the opener. Kym, meanwhile, defeated Sascha Gueymard Wayenburg 7-6(1), 7-5 to reach the last eight. The pair has no prior head-to-head record. Piros enters with solid recent clay results and momentum from the three-set victory, while Kym looks to build on consistent early-round performances in the tournament.
